Employees Are Your Social Media Champions

A Gallup poll finds that 81% of engaged workers are more likely to give their employer’s products and services a positive recommendation on social media in comparison to only 18% of actively disengaged workers.

How to Pitch Your Messages on Twitter

Humour, sarcasm and satire don’t translate well on social media. Remember that even if your clients are local, your audience is potentially global on Twitter.
